diff options
author | Sergei Petrunia <psergey@askmonty.org> | 2015-03-07 22:47:28 +0300 |
---|---|---|
committer | Sergei Petrunia <psergey@askmonty.org> | 2015-03-07 22:47:28 +0300 |
commit | 1626e0d3d48f56bd91239c4fcbc24595ee3a34e3 (patch) | |
tree | 6d92530c4d9c2f47030be63f9cfc851636107ae5 /sql/mysqld.h | |
parent | 2288b84df46501b89a70d7dc3b46020e0af9a95e (diff) | |
download | mariadb-git-1626e0d3d48f56bd91239c4fcbc24595ee3a34e3.tar.gz |
MDEV-7648: Extra data in ANALYZE FORMAT=JSON $stmt
Show total execution time (r_total_time_ms) for various parts of the
query:
1. time spent in SELECTs
2. time spent reading rows from storage engines
#2 currently gets the data from P_S.
Diffstat (limited to 'sql/mysqld.h')
-rw-r--r-- | sql/mysqld.h |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/sql/mysqld.h b/sql/mysqld.h index bfce719a280..b414e5168b2 100644 --- a/sql/mysqld.h +++ b/sql/mysqld.h @@ -26,6 +26,7 @@ #include "sql_cmd.h" #include <my_rnd.h> #include "my_pthread.h" +#include "my_rdtsc.h" class THD; struct handlerton; @@ -60,6 +61,8 @@ typedef Bitmap<((MAX_INDEXES+7)/8*8)> key_map; /* Used for finding keys */ #define OPT_SESSION SHOW_OPT_SESSION #define OPT_GLOBAL SHOW_OPT_GLOBAL +extern MY_TIMER_INFO sys_timer_info; + /* Values for --slave-parallel-mode Must match order in slave_parallel_mode_typelib in sys_vars.cc. |